Affording exceptionally fine downland views - a spaciously proportioned 5 bedroom detached house with glorious gardens and grounds of about 8 acres. The property has been extensively improved over the ears and now benefits from a magnificent refitted Neptune kitchen. Spectacular downland views are afforded and the property secures a high degree of privacy. Properties with acreage in the downland villages rarely come to the market and an early appointment to view is strongly recommended to appreciate the high merit and appeal of this exceptionally fine setting.

Little Paddocks is enviably situated within miles of scenic downland countryside within the exclusive hamlet of Milton Street. The village of Alfriston is close by and offers excellent shopping facilities and fine dining opportunities as well as an ancient parish church. The glorious surrounding downland countryside of the National Park offers outstanding recreational opportunity. The sea is just to the south at Exceat. The principal nearby town of Eastbourne offers a wide range of amenities and private schools. There are rail services from Berwick Station, Polegate and Eastbourne to London Victoria and to Gatwick. World class opera is at nearby Glyndebourne and Channel ferries are from Newhaven.
